Position Summary

EnerStar Solutions is seeking a Customer Success Manager to own, retain, strengthen and grow relationships with the Starlink Division's key customers. The initial portfolio will focus on EnerStar's top 20% of accounts, with additional accounts assigned as the division scales.


This is an account-ownership role, not a customer-service coordinator position. Following a structured handoff from Sales and implementation, the Customer Success Manager becomes the primary commercial and relationship owner for assigned customers. The role is accountable for customer value, retention, satisfaction, renewals, account health, structured business reviews and appropriate growth within existing accounts.


The successful candidate will be proactive, commercially minded, highly organized and comfortable working with enterprise, government, healthcare, oil and gas, emergency-response and other remote-industry customers across the United States and Canada.


This role is ideal for candidates who enjoy building long-term customer partnerships, leading strategic business reviews, driving customer retention, and identifying growth opportunities within enterprise accounts. You will serve as the primary relationship owner for a portfolio of key customers across North America.


Customer Ownership Model

  • Sales executives remain focused primarily on prospecting, developing and closing new customers.
  • After implementation and a documented handoff, the Customer Success Manager owns the day-to-day relationship, customer success plan, renewals and routine growth within the assigned account.
  • Routine additions of kits, managed services and established EnerStar offerings are handled directly by the Customer Success Manager.
  • The originating sales executive may be brought back into major enterprise expansions, strategic opportunities, competitive pursuits or technically complex solutions, with responsibilities agreed at the outset.
  • Account assignments, transfer timing, revenue credit and commission treatment will be documented through a separate Sales-to-CSM account-transition policy.
